tcp: Fix data-races around sysctl_tcp_max_reordering.
stable inclusion from stable-v5.10.134 commit 064852663308c801861bd54789d81421fa4c2928 category: bugfix bugzilla: https://gitee.com/openeuler/kernel/issues/I5ZVR7 Reference: https://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/stable/linux.git/commit/?id=064852663308c801861bd54789d81421fa4c2928 -------------------------------- [ Upstream commit a11e5b3e ] While reading sysctl_tcp_max_reordering, it can be changed concurrently. Thus, we need to add READ_ONCE() to its readers. Fixes: dca145ff ("tcp: allow for bigger reordering level") Signed-off-by: NKuniyuki Iwashima <kuniyu@amazon.com> Signed-off-by: NDavid S.
